I recently started a thread called, What Iron to buy? I never realized what a hassel it would become! I started with the Panasonic cordless. It was heavy, did not heat up nearly hot enough, and even though I rarely use steam, I tried that and it leaked like a sieve! It was also heavy for me as my strength is compromised by the Chemo I am on now. The constant picking it up and returning it to the base was a real problem and it would not slide down completely into the base many times, as I thought it was reheating when in fact it was not down far enough to connect with the heating element. Returned it and purchased a Hamilton Beach corded iron. The cord swivels so that was not a problem any longer, like it was with my old iron. A nice iron all but for the coated base plate. I then learned about the Maytag with the Stainless Steel base plate, swivel extra long cord, and auto 3 way safety shutoff, and heats to maximum temp in 55 seconds. Even has a removable water tan. (All the bells and whistles.) It even has a non tipping feature that makes it hard to accidentally knock over, yet tips easily for use; an additional bonus feature they do not even advertise! It has the best even-steam distribution system I have ever seen or used, offering about twice the number of vents in the Stainless Steel base. Even though the iron has some weight to it, its designed so its easy to tip to use, so its the best of both worlds. Its a Maytag Model M-800 and comes with a two year guarantee. They say "The third time's the charm" and in this case its true... Its the best iron I have ever owned. Who ever thought one could LOVE an iron? But I do!
